返回

揭开机器学习的神秘面纱:探索 LTV 预测模型的运作方式

人工智能

机器学习 LTV 预测:利用数据预测客户价值

在竞争激烈的数字时代,了解客户行为对于企业成功至关重要。机器学习,这一人工智能变革的力量,为企业提供了预测客户生命周期价值 (LTV) 的强大工具。本文将深入探讨机器学习 LTV 预测模型,揭示其如何利用数据分析和算法的力量来预测客户的未来收益。

机器学习赋能 LTV 预测

机器学习允许计算机从数据中学习,无需明确编程,从而进行预测。LTV 预测模型利用这种能力,从客户行为数据中学习模式,从而预测他们未来的收益。

预测模型的工作原理

LTV 预测模型基于一个假设:客户的过去行为和特征可以用来预测他们的未来行为和价值。这些模型使用监督学习技术,其中已知客户 LTV 值的数据集用于训练模型。通过训练,模型了解客户特征和行为与 LTV 之间的关系。

一旦训练完成,模型就可以应用于新客户或现有客户群,以预测他们的 LTV。模型根据客户的人口统计信息、购买历史、参与度指标和其他相关特征进行预测。

影响 LTV 预测的因素

影响 LTV 预测准确性的因素包括:

  • 数据质量: 训练数据集必须准确且完整,以确保预测的可靠性。
  • 特征选择: 特征的选择对于准确预测至关重要。需要考虑相关性、可用性和预测能力。
  • 算法选择: 有各种机器学习算法可用于 LTV 预测,包括决策树、回归模型和神经网络。算法的选择取决于数据的性质和预测问题的复杂性。
  • 模型训练: 模型训练涉及调整参数以最大化预测准确性。超参数优化技术可用于找到最佳模型配置。
  • 模型评估: 在部署模型之前,必须评估其在独立数据集上的性能,以确保其泛化能力。

LTV 预测模型的应用

LTV 预测模型为企业提供了以下关键应用:

  • 客户细分: 将客户细分为具有相似 LTV 特征的群体,以定制营销策略并优化客户体验。
  • 营销优化: 根据客户的 LTV 预测,优化营销活动,将资源集中在高价值客户上,同时减少对低价值客户的支出。
  • 客户关系管理: 通过识别高 LTV 客户,企业可以优先建立更牢固的客户关系,提高客户忠诚度和留存率。
  • 收入预测: LTV 预测模型可用于预测未来的收入,从而帮助企业进行财务规划和资源分配。

代码示例

以下 Python 代码示例展示了如何使用机器学习来预测客户 LTV:

import pandas as pd
from sklearn.model_selection import train_test_split
from sklearn.linear_model import LinearRegression

# 加载数据
data = pd.read_csv('customer_data.csv')

# 准备训练数据
features = ['age', 'gender', 'purchase_history']
target = 'ltv'
X_train, X_test, y_train, y_test = train_test_split(data[features], data[target], test_size=0.2)

# 训练模型
model = LinearRegression()
model.fit(X_train, y_train)

# 预测 LTV
y_pred = model.predict(X_test)

常见问题解答

1. LTV 预测模型的准确性有多高?

准确性取决于多种因素,包括数据质量、特征选择和模型选择。一般来说,LTV 预测模型可以提供合理的准确性,特别是对于大型数据集。

2. 如何使用 LTV 预测模型?

LTV 预测模型可用于客户细分、营销优化、客户关系管理和收入预测。

3. 实施 LTV 预测模型需要哪些资源?

需要数据集、机器学习专业知识和计算资源。

4. 如何持续提高 LTV 预测模型的准确性?

通过不断收集和分析客户数据,并重新训练模型,可以提高模型的准确性。

5. 机器学习 LTV 预测模型有哪些潜在的局限性?

潜在的局限性包括数据偏差、模型复杂性和过拟合风险。